If you know more information about Neil Stewart help us to improve this page
Neil Stewart is an actor, known for Gekijô-ban poketto monsutâ: Maboroshi no pokemon: Rugia bakutan (1999), uwantme2killhim? (2013) and The Fountain of Death (1996).